Abstract

The utility model relates to ore extractive technique fields, and disclose a kind of dissolution slot structure extracted for ore, including slot ontology, fixed lid is fixedly installed at the top of the slot ontology, the left side through slot ontology is fixedly installed on the left of the slot ontology and extends to the feed pipe of slot body interior, the top of the fixed lid is fixedly installed with the top through fixed lid and extends to the feed hopper of slot body interior, the top of the fixed lid is fixedly installed with the cabinet on the left of feed hopper, the inside of the cabinet is fixedly installed with output shaft through the top of fixed lid and extends to the motor of slot body interior, the inside of the slot ontology is fixedly installed with heating device.This is used for the dissolution slot structure that ore extracts, and mineral dust to be dissolved is added by feed hopper, so that dissolved efficiency gets a promotion, accelerate dissolution, productivity effect is improved the time required to reducing production, and the impurity generated after dissolving is convenient to clean, reduce dissolved operation difficulty, increases production efficiency.

A kind of dissolution slot structure extracted for ore
Technical field
The utility model relates to ore extractive technique field, specially a kind of dissolution slot structure extracted for ore.
Background technique
Ore refers to the mineral aggregate that can therefrom extract useful constituent or itself have certain performance that can be utilized, Metalliferous mineral and nonmetallic mineral can be divided into, the unit content of useful component is known as the grade of ore in ore, your gold such as gold and platinum Belong to ore with g ton indicating, other ores are often indicated with percentage, commonly use the grade of ore to measure the value of ore, but equally Gangue in effective component ore, i.e., useless mineral or the little and unavailable mineralogical composition of useful component content in ore and Objectionable impurities number also influence ore value.
The dissolution slot structure dissolved efficiency extracted for ore existing at present is not high, so that dissolution is slowly, increases life The time required to producing, and the impurity generated after dissolving is difficult to clear up, and increases operation difficulty, mentions so proposing one kind for ore The dissolution slot structure taken is set forth above to solve the problems, such as.

(3) beneficial effect
Compared with prior art, the utility model provides a kind of dissolution slot structure extracted for ore, has following The utility model has the advantages that
This is used for dissolution slot structure that ore extracts, and mineral dust to be dissolved is added by feed hopper, by feed pipe plus Enter solvent, is added and completes post heating device starting, slot ontology is internally heated, while electric motor starting, drive rotating bar Rotation, so that connecting plate and agitating plate are stirred mixed solution, by the heating of heating device, so that intermolecular movement is fast Rate is accelerated, while the stirring of connecting plate and agitating plate to mixed solution, so that solvent is uniformly mixed with mineral dust, acceleration molecular Between diffusion motion, reach rapidly-soluble purpose, so that dissolved efficiency gets a promotion, accelerate dissolution, reduce production and being taken Between improve productivity effect, after the completion of dissolution, electromagnetic valve is opened, and water pump starting, internal mix solution provided by water pump Pressure enters filtering cabin and collecting box by connecting tube, can be stopped impurity inside solution in the inside of collecting box by strainer, So that filtered solution is flowed out by discharge nozzle, pull handle proposes collecting box after the completion of filtering, that is, can be taken off internal miscellaneous Matter, impurity can be poured out cleaning by opening case lid, so that the impurity generated after dissolution is convenient to clean, it is difficult to reduce dissolved operation Degree increases production efficiency.

Specific embodiment
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work Every other embodiment obtained, fall within the protection scope of the utility model.
A kind of dissolution slot structure extracted for ore referring to FIG. 1-2, including slot ontology 1, the bottom of slot ontology 1 be in Arc, the top of slot ontology 1 are fixedly installed with fixed lid 2, and the left side of slot ontology 1 is fixedly installed with through the left side of slot ontology 1 And the feed pipe 3 inside slot ontology 1 is extended to, the top of fixed lid 2 is fixedly installed with the top through fixed lid 2 and extends to Feed hopper 4 inside slot ontology 1, the top of feed hopper 4 is tapered, and the top of fixed lid 2 is fixedly installed with left positioned at feed hopper 4 The cabinet 5 of side, the outside of cabinet 5 offer equally distributed heat release hole, and the inside of cabinet 5 is fixedly installed with output shaft through solid Determine the top of lid 2 and extend to the motor 6 inside slot ontology 1, the model of motor 6 can be 35BYG250B-0081, slot ontology 1 Inside is fixedly installed with heating device 7, and heating device 7 is made of isolation board and heating tube, and heating tube is fixedly installed in isolation board Inside, the rotating bar 8 being fixedly installed on the output shaft of motor 6 inside slot ontology 1, the external fixed peace of rotating bar 8 Equipped with connecting plate 9, the quantity of connecting plate 9 is four, and the top and bottom of connecting plate 9 is fixedly installed with agitating plate 10, slot sheet The bottom of body 1 is fixedly installed with the connecting tube 11 inside connectivity slot ontology 1, and the top of connecting tube 11 is fixedly installed with positioned at slot sheet The water pump 12 on 1 right side of body, the model of water pump 12 can be 150HW-8, and the right side of connecting tube 11 is fixedly installed with to be connected with connecting tube 11 Logical filtering cabin 13, the internal activity of filtering cabin 13 are equipped with collecting box 14, and the right side opening of collecting box 14, which is equipped with to be located at, to be connected The feed inlet on 11 right side of adapter tube, the top movable of collecting box 14 are equipped with case lid 15, and the top of case lid 15 is fixedly installed with handle 16, the outside of handle 16 is provided with increasing resistance striped, and the right side of filtering cabin 13 is fixedly installed with the discharge nozzle being connected to filtering cabin 13 17, the right side opening of collecting box 14 is equipped with the discharge port for being located at 17 left side of discharge nozzle, and the fixed peace in the left side of collecting box 14 turns to have to be located at Strainer 18 inside filtering cabin 13, strainer 18 are fixedly installed in the inside of discharge port, the outside of connecting tube 11 and are located at slot ontology 1 Bottom be fixedly installed with electromagnetic valve 19, the model of electromagnetic valve 19 can be DN50, and ore to be dissolved is added by feed hopper 4 Solvent is added by feed pipe 3 in powder, is added and completes the starting of post heating device 7, to being internally heated for slot ontology 1, simultaneously Motor 6 starts, and rotating bar 8 is driven to rotate, so that connecting plate 9 is stirred mixed solution with agitating plate 10, is filled by heating 7 heating is set, so that intermolecular movement rate is accelerated, while connecting plate 9 and stirring of the agitating plate 10 to mixed solution, so that molten Agent is uniformly mixed with mineral dust, and the diffusion motion between acceleration molecular reaches rapidly-soluble purpose, so that dissolved efficiency obtains It is promoted, accelerates dissolution, improve productivity effect the time required to reducing production, after the completion of dissolution, electromagnetic valve 19 is opened, water pump 12 Starting, internal mix solution enter filtering cabin 13 and collecting box 14 by connecting tube 11 by the pressure that water pump 12 provides, pass through Strainer 18 can stop impurity inside solution in the inside of collecting box 14, so that filtered solution is flowed out by discharge nozzle 17, Pull handle 16 proposes collecting box 14 after the completion of filtering, that is, can be taken off internal impurity, and impurity can be poured out by opening case lid 15 Cleaning reduces dissolved operation difficulty so that the impurity generated after dissolution is convenient to clean, and increases production efficiency.
